Chamrahi - Garhwa

Chamrahi is a village situated in the Garhwa subdivision of Garhwa district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 15 km from Garhwa, which serves as both the tehsil and district headquarters. Sangrahe Khurd ser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chamrahi village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chamrahi is 347719. The village covers a total geographical area of 121 hectares and falls under the 822114 pincode. Garhwa is the nearest town.

Chamrahi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Chamrahi

As per Census 2011, Chamrahi village has a total population of 1,124 people, consisting of 579 males and 545 females. The village has 227 households and a sex ratio of 941 females per 1,000 males. There are 189 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 584 literate and 540 illiterate residents.

Transport and Connectivity of Chamrahi

Chamrahi is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Sigsigi,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 135.3 km.
